A young girl is killed while walking with her mother when an Upper East Side brownstone explodes. Detectives Ed Green and Nina Cassady quickly determine that faulty wiring is to blame and their investigation leads to the building owner's ex-wife. But with only circumstantial evidence, it's difficult for A.D.A.s Jack McCoy and Connie Rubirosa to prove their case.

Green and Cassady suspect arson in a string of church fires, but the discovery of a body in the ruins shifts the focus of the investigation to homicide.
When a rap musician is found murdered the reason for her demise may not be the obvious one. With several suspects to choose from, Detectives Ed Green and Nina Cassady are determined to find out whether it was a random homicide or if it was connected to her work in the music business.
Karl Rostov dies at the hospital after symptoms of a severe stomach flu. The FBI is under the impression that they are dealing with terrorism until the medical examiner finds Ricin in Rostov's body. As Detectives Ed Green and Nina Cassady dig further a mystery surrounding Rostov's life is unraveled.

Detectives Ed Green and Nina Cassady come together to investigate the death of two homeless men who happen to die on the same day. As the investigation deepens, they come across an odd coincidence that may connect the deaths.
The ex-wife of a prominent former senator Randall Bailey is found brutally murdered at home the night after a fundraiser she attended with her family. Although Bailey cooperates with Detectives Ed Green and Nina Cassady, they question his innocence after finding him standing over another family member's dead body. His indictment for both murders turns the courtroom into a media circus.
